Prairie Street Brewing Company just dropped a Memorial Day weekend menu that is perfect for the whole family. If you like to (wo)man the grill, don't worry. This special menu has two preparedness options, ready to eat and ready to heat. If you're looking to order meat from the grill you need to put in that order by 5 p.m. Friday, May 21, 2020. You can also pre-order a prepared meal option as well but it's not absolutely necessary.

For the "Ready To Ear" options, there's a bbq pulled pork family meal that feeds six. There's also a "Memorial Day pulled pork and ribs combo" that will feed 8. These come with a choice of sides, like mac-n-cheese, apple coleslaw, potato salad, and more. Oh, and those are quart-sized.

There are four different "ready to heat" options that sound delicious, all to be grilled with one of their craft beers in mind. Some of the options include bone-in McKenna Berkshire pork chops, Amish beer can chicken, and Korean beef shish kabobs, and more. Each option serves 6.
